I’m not ungrate ful this tit.io. 1 say it, t(*>—God bless you!"—Gentleman’s Magazine. an K.levator* During ar inthrastiug test of the safe ty of the air high sja-ed patssenger ele-j vators in the Etpiitable Inplding one of the cars was raised to the niiilli floor of the structure and a prop ptiWmder it. The wires which generally held it in its j rise nnd descent were then cut, and all Was ready for the.test. The cars weigh about 1,000 pounds each, ami this was thought sufficient .Weight. On the floor of the car wore placed a half dozen eggs, a coufde of glasses of water, an incandescent elec-'* trie light bulb nnd a sheet of. window glass. At a given signal the prvpwns knocked away, and tlie ear went rattling and cluttering down, ft took less than three seconds to make the trip, and then it settled slowly down into the air cush ion well. When tl 3 cage was njM*ned, it was found that one of the eggs liaif*ns-j»hel] cracked, and a little of tlie water laid lieen slopjied over the sides of the glassy*. Otherwise the' contents were uninjured, and so ft is supisised Would lie the ease with passengers should an accident be fall the car while any one was in it. The wells which are provided for these cases are five feet deep below tho baso- nient llis>r.' They: are built of solid con:. ■ w-itU. walls slightly, sloping, from a size a little larger than the floor of the car to an exact fit for it. When the car drop* into it, the compressed air forms a cushion, and valves are provided with ‘ mathematical precision to allow the 1 es cape of thauir just fast enough to allow-* the car to kettle down gently and with- #. out injurr.—Baltimore News. > 1 Tlie first savings bank was instituted rt Berne in Switzerland in 1787.
